Effective Treatment of the Burn Injuries

Article Summary   by:david1344     Original Author: David
ª
 
There is proper classification of the burn injuries on the basis of the severity such as first degree, second degree, third degree and fourth degree. These classifications are the major aspects of predicting the current condition of the victim injury. Similarly, on the basis of these classifications we have to apply the treatment measures. Sometimes, these injuries could further broadly categorized as minor and major injury. Therefore, people need to have some basic insights of the injuries in order to apply effective treatments.

Fire is not only the cause of the burn injury hence you have to know that there are several other causes of the injuries such as radiation, electrical, scalding and others. However, treatments are common for all of them depending on the degree of the burn.

• First degree of burn treatment – As its name depicts, it is the least critical situation for the victim where heat only extends to the outer layer of the body, epidermis. Victim will feel pain and have some red color appearance on the skin which part exposed to the heat. Thus, this injury could be healed within minimum one week through the home remedies itself without visiting to the clinic. Simply follow the basic first aid method such as has applying the antiseptic cream on the burn place.

• Second degree burn treatments - As its name refers, it is second degree of injury where deep part of body gets affected with heat which is called hypodermis. In this case victims will suffer from severe pain and get swelling in the burnt place. However, some scarring could also be appeared with the passage of time. In this case you are required to make visit to the hospital and clinic.

• Third degree burn treatments – There is nothing to recommend rather than simply rush for the instant intensive care.

• Fourth Degree Burn treatments – Instead of squandering your time, approach to the best clinic in your nearby areas. The more prompt action you will take reaching to the doctor the better result you will get in terms of less catastrophic outcome.

Some common treatments:

• If the burn injury is minor, you just expose the area to the cold water for 10 minutes. Instead of using ice cubes you just expose your burned areas to the water. Use burn ointments to alleviate the pain and get some relief form eth cream. Avoid applying oil and butter kind of substances.

• In case you are suffering from the major burn injuries, do not use water or other methods instead running to the medical care only. Make sure you remove extra cloth and other accessories as soon as possible before reaching to the doctor.
